Remove Charitable status from public/private schools

Additional Information

I think it is wrong that public/private schools have charitable status, and thus avoid VAT and other taxes. Most of these schools are used by well off and privalidged people and they should pay taxes for this kind of service and not get tax breaks and discounts for what is in reality a luxury. These schools are only available on the whole to those who can afford the fees and do not realy fit the idea of a charity. I believe that if a school can prove that they really are acting as a charity i.e. the majority of places being given free to bright kids not rich ones, then they should retain the status of a charity. But schools like Eaton etc should have to pay taxes as a bussiness inc VAT.
